What happens if a will is not filed in Florida?
If probate is not filed, the probate court will not distribute the assets of the estate. The probate process provides a legal mechanism for resolving disputes over the estate, and without it, beneficiaries may have to resort to litigation to assert their rights. -
Who can contest a Florida will?
Individuals who can contest a will include: Beneficiaries named in the current will. Beneficiaries of a previous version of the will. Individuals not named in the will but may have been eligible to inherit the estate due to intestacy laws. -
How long can a will be contested in Florida?
Florida law mandates a strict filing deadline for will contests. Any interested person must file a formal lawsuit contesting the will within 90 days after the filing of the Notice of Administration—the document filed by the estate's personal representative notifying the decedent's heirs of probate court proceedings. -

Can an estate be settled without probate in Florida?
Florida generally has two different types of probate - one is easy, one is much more complicated - and probate can take 5-8 months under most scenarios. Some estates won't need to go through formal probate at all. If a deceased person had no assets in their own, individual name, then no probate is required. -
Do Florida wills have to be recorded?
No, a Florida will does not need to be recorded to be validly executed. However, your will is probated after you die, and at that point it will be part of the public record. Some legal documents need to be recorded. Recording means making a public record of your transaction. -
What voids a will in Florida?
While a will can be declared void if it was procured by fraud, duress, or undue influence, a mistake in the drafting or execution of a will may not be grounds to invalidate the entire document. -
Does a will have to be filed after death Florida?
The custodian of a Will must deposit the original copy of the Will with the clerk of the Court having the venue of the decedent's estate within 10 days of receiving information that the testator is dead. (S. 732.901, Florida Statutes.) There is no fee to deposit the Will with the clerk of Court.
